snufIn the annals of horror fiction, the concept of snuff kits has long been a subject of gruesome fascination. However, what was once confined to the realms of imagination and urban legends has seeped into the chilling reality of our world. snuff kit, once believed to be mere figments of a disturbed mind, have emerged […]